How to Reach

There are several ways to reach Seville from Puertollano:

  • By train: There are several daily trains that run from Puertollano to Seville. The journey takes about 2 hours and 30 minutes.
  • By bus: There are also several daily buses that run from Puertollano to Seville. The journey takes about 3 hours.
  • By car: The drive from Puertollano to Seville takes about 2 hours and 30 minutes.

Expenses

The cost of traveling from Puertollano to Seville will vary depending on the mode of transportation and the time of year. However, here is a general estimate of the costs:

  • Train: €20-€30
  • Bus: €15-€25
  • Car: €20-€30 (gasoline)

What to Eat

Seville is known for its delicious food. Here are some of the must-try dishes:

  • Gazpacho: A cold tomato soup
  • Salmorejo: A thicker version of gazpacho
  • Flamenquin: A fried pork roll
  • Tortilla de patatas: A Spanish omelet
  • Churros: Fried dough pastries

Where to Go

Seville is a beautiful city with a lot to offer visitors. Here are some of the top attractions:

  • The Cathedral of Seville: The largest Gothic cathedral in the world
  • The Alcázar of Seville: A beautiful palace built by the Moorish kings
  • The Plaza de Toros de Sevilla: One of the largest bullrings in the world
  • The Parque de María Luisa: A beautiful park with gardens, fountains, and sculptures
  • The Torre del Oro: A 13th-century watchtower
